The Head Cook is responsible for providing a high standard of varied and nutritional diets to the care home residents while maintaining budgetary control of the processes as per CQC standards. To oversee the kitchen operation at Pembroke House.

To ensure all statutory Hygiene and Health & Safety Regulations are adhered to and records are kept up to date.

Key Responsibilities

  • Co-ordinate all aspects of kitchen production so that food is prepared to the agreed standard and that time deadlines are met.
  • Implement and supervise all aspects of kitchen control e.g. menus, hygiene, health and safety, staff, cleaning and waste control.
  • Supervise and develop staff training.
  • Attend statutory training.
  • Order catering consumables from nominated suppliers.
  • Maintain computerised stock accounting.
  • Prepare menus for the Home taking into account the content, balance, colour and nutritional values.
  • Prepare special diets for Service Users as directed by the nursing staff.
  • Maintain the agreed stock levels of food.
  • Implement, record and maintain an agreed cleaning schedule for the kitchen.
  • Carry out stock takes at the end of each month as directed by the Home Manager.
  • Organise and control kitchen working hours.
  • Work within agreed budget guidelines on staff costs and consumables and co-operate in any action necessary to keep to the budget.
  • Account for food supplied to staff.
  • Maintain HACCP records.
